Te Whiwhinga mahi | The opportunity The Liggins Institute is establishing the Cerebral Palsy project, a precision medicine initiative based on whole genome sequencing for individuals with cerebral palsy. We are seeking a Postdoctoral Fellow to join our team at The Liggins Institute, to contribute to the curation and bioinformatics component of the Cerebral Palsy project. We will initially screen for ~ 250 mutations and then take a whole-of-genome approach, incorporating our long-read research pipeline, developed through our acute care genetics experience.
Artificial intelligence and machine learning techniques will be used to align genotype with phenotype.
You will be responsible for conducting research and analysis agreed on with the Cerebral Palsy project Principal Investigator (PI) according to standard protocol and procedures, and in keeping with ethical requirements.
